Tender Title: Annual Rate Contract for Repair and Maintenance of Passing and Globe Valves
Tender Reference Number: GEM/2025/B/6139900
Issuing Authority
The tender is issued by the Indian Oil Corporation Limited, under the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as.
Scope of Work and Objectives
The primary aim of this tender is to establish an Annual Rate Contract for the repair and maintenance of passing ball valves and globe valves specifically for PHBMPL stations. The scope includes providing comprehensive services that ensure optimal functionality, reliability, and safety of the valve systems utilized within the organization's operational framework.
